Tucked amid the rolling farmland of Jefferson County, Canaan delights residents with its wide-open spaces and welcoming atmosphere, making it particularly appealing for those seeking tranquility without sacrificing a sense of belonging. The region is renowned for its Canaan Fall Festival, drawing visitors and local families alike every September for crafts, games, music, and delicious home-cooked fare, reflecting the area’s proud agricultural heritage.
Education in Canaan is anchored by the Southwestern-Jefferson County Consolidated Schools, where smaller class sizes encourage close-knit learning communities. Just a short drive away, additional academic options and enrichment opportunities await in Madison, which broadens horizons through after-school programs, libraries, and youth sports.
Outdoor enthusiasts appreciate Canaan’s proximity to Big Oaks National Wildlife Refuge and the recreational choices of Versailles State Park, making it easy to spend weekends fishing, hunting, hiking, or birdwatching. Local charm is further enhanced by the annual Swiss Wine Festival in Vevay and the historic streets of Carrollton across the river, giving residents plenty to explore regionally.
